New Jersey also has a online catalog of maps.

All type of stuff. New Jersey Geographic Information Network the site is not that intuitive, and the search function in pretty poor. The browse function works but it's tedious.

This is not a beginers site or a click and point user friendly resource. If you know what your looking for you can get it quickly and there is a ton of information there.

For most of the aerial maps you'll need Mr.Sid or Arc View, and the resolution is incredible.

The NJDEP's IMAP site link is pretty good. You can turn various layers on and off (roads, waterways, hazmat sites, etc...) I think the aerials are from 2002. The resolution is better than the google maps (and doesn't have that crazy watermark)
